NON-FINANCIAL RISKS
Our global footprint and the diversity of our activities expose us to labour, environmental and societal risks both internally and in relation to our business relationships and products. MANE operates in a constantly changing economic, competitive and technological environment. In 2021, we revised our non-financial risk mapping and our materiality analysis. It is aligned with our CSR strategy and presents the risks and opportunities identified in relation to some of our commitments. The table below contains the following items: main risks identified, description of their potential impacts on the company and policies applied to address them. The description of these policies and their results are communicated throughout this report in each of the corresponding chapters.
